Commentary on the Ten Maxims of Sahaj Marg Book PDF Summary
In this book, Ram Chandra has endeavoured to put into words those spiritual secrets that had previously been passed down from spiritual teacher to student silently through vibrations – from heart to heart. They relate to direct perception, to the study of Nature. Instead of focusing on what not to do, he shows us what we can do to mould our lifestyle to be in tune with our spiritual journey. The ten guiding principles are beautifully designed to follow the natural cycle of the day, starting with rising and meditating before dawn and finishing with the practices to be done just before sleeping at night. In between, he focuses on the principles that help us to meet the challenges of daily lives: being in tune with Nature, being authentic, accepting what comes, letting go of negative emotions and guilt, nurturing human oneness and unity in diversity, cultivating positive attitudes towards resources like food and money, and changing behavioural patterns that are limiting. If practised, these Maxims are ten steps to eternal peace and fulfilment in life.
